The probability of the Fed cutting interest rates by 25 basis points in May is 57%.

PANews reported on April 8 that according to CME's "Fed Watch": The probability of the Fed keeping interest rates unchanged in May is 43%, and the probability of a 25 basis point rate cut is 57%. The probability of the Fed keeping interest rates unchanged in June is 20.4, the probability of a cumulative 25 basis point rate cut is 49.7%, and the probability of a cumulative 50 basis point rate cut is 29.9%.
